#4c278f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c278f is composed of 29.8% red, 15.3%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.9%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 261.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 35.7%. #4c278f color hex could be obtained by blending #984eff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#4c278f color description : Dark violet.
#4c278f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c278f has RGB values of R:76, G:39,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4990863.

Shades and Tints of #4c278f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f7f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c278f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a585e is the less saturated color, while #4204b2 is the most saturated one.
